Problem

The installation and validation of platform seals in gas turbine engines are challenging due to their blind assembly nature, making it difficult to ensure proper installation and inspection, which can lead to incorrect placement and increased maintenance time.

Innovation Solution

A platform seal assembly with a validation tab that extends radially through the slash face gap, allowing for visual verification of correct installation and orientation, and includes validation codes to confirm the correct seal and blade compatibility.

AI summary

A platform seal assembly for a gas turbine engine with a turbine disk and a plurality of turbine blades is disclosed. The platform seal assembly includes a platform seal and a validation tab. The platform seal includes a first end, a second end, opposite and distal to the first end, and a body extending between the first end and the second end. The validation tab includes an attachment portion affixed to the platform seal and an observable indicator portion extending from the attachment portion.
